Our client, based within the telecoms sector, is looking for a temporary Employee Relations (ER) Officer to join their HR team. This temporary role is to provide cover during a period of sickness absence. Contracts are reviewed weekly, with extensions agreed while cover remains necessary.
You will provide full ER support service within the HR team and to internal and external customers. You will act as a first point of contact for ER and HR enquiries and contribute to and support on strategic HR projects.
Role: Employee Relations Officer
Start Date: ASAP
Contract Length: temporary role to provide cover during a period of sickness absence.
Location: hybrid – 3 days a week in either Irlam or Telford office
Rate: £27 per hour
Pay framework: inside IR35 – Umbrella Company
Responsibilities:
- Respond to all employee and manager queries relating to policies and procedures and provide comprehensive advice
- Prepare ER, and where needed HR related reports
- Draft outcome letters and HR policies
- Manage a portfolio of ER cases, at various levels. This includes performance improvement processes and absence management cases.
- Give advice and support to department managers on various ER and HR policies and processes
- Track and respond to queries and cases.
- Assess workplace situations and evaluate information to draw accurate observations in relation to a case or situation. Complete risk identification and assessment against each case and ensure that this is managed accordingly
- Contribute to HR data governance
- Identify opportunities for continuous process improvement within the team
- Provide support to the wider HR team as and when required and respond to HR Operations queries
Requirements:
- Qualified or working towards a CIPD Level 5 or have equivalent experience
- Experience of HR and employee relations case management
- Experience of working within a fast-paced environment with different departments

How to prepare for a job interview at Diana Duggan Associates
✨Know Your ER Basics
Brush up on your knowledge of employee relations policies and procedures. Be ready to discuss how you've handled ER cases in the past, as well as any relevant HR legislation. This will show that you’re not just familiar with the theory but can apply it practically.
✨Prepare for Scenario Questions
Expect to be asked about specific situations you might face as an ER Officer. Think of examples from your previous experience where you successfully managed performance improvement processes or absence management cases.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your answers.
✨Show Your Communication Skills
As a first point of contact for ER and HR enquiries, strong communication is key. Practice articulating your thoughts clearly and confidently. You might even want to prepare a few questions to ask the interviewer about their current ER challenges, showing your proactive approach.
✨Highlight Your Adaptability
Since this role is temporary and in a fast-paced environment, emphasise your ability to adapt quickly. Share examples of how you've thrived in dynamic settings and contributed to process improvements. This will demonstrate that you can hit the ground running and support the team effectively.
